Job Description

This is for the 2024 - 2025 school year

Certified Teachers starting at $58,500*

Non-Certified Teachers starting at $55,500*

*All starting amounts include a $2,000 STAAR Tested Grade-Level hiring incentive and a $1,000 High school Stipend

Primary Purpose:

Provide students with appropriate learning activities and experiences in the core academic subject area assigned to help them fulfill their potential for intellectual, emotional, physical, and social growth. Enable students to develop competencies and skills to function successfully in society.

Qualifications:

Education/Certification:

Bachelor’s degree from accredited university Valid Texas teaching certificate with required endorsements or training for subject and level assigned-preferred

Demonstrated competency in the core academic subject area assigned

Special Knowledge/Skills:

Knowledge of core academic subject assigned

Knowledge of curriculum and instruction

Ability to instruct students and manage their behavior

Strong organizational, communication, and interpersonal skills

Experience: One-year student teaching or approved internship preferred

Major Responsibilities and Duties:

Instructional Strategies

1. Develop and implement lesson plans that fulfill the requirements of district’s curriculum

program and show written evidence of preparation as required. Prepare lessons that reflect

accommodations for differences in individual student differences.

2. Plan and use appropriate instructional and learning strategies, activities, materials, equipment,

and technology that reflect understanding of the learning styles and needs of students assigned

and present subject matter according to guidelines established by Texas Education Agency,

board policies, and administrative regulations.

3. Conduct assessment of student learning styles and use results to plan instructional activities.

4. Work cooperatively with special education teachers to modify curricula as needed for special

education students according to guidelines established in Individual Education Plans (IEP).

5. Work with other members of staff to determine instructional goals, objectives, and methods

according to district requirements.

6. Plan and assign work to instructional aide(s) and volunteer(s) and oversee completion.

Student Growth and Development

7. Conduct ongoing assessment of student achievement through formal and informal testing.

8. Assume responsibility for extracurricular activities as assigned. Sponsor outside activities

approved by the campus principal.

9. Be a positive role model for students; support mission of school district.

Classroom Management and Organization

10. Create classroom environment conducive to learning and appropriate for the physical, social,

and emotional development of students.

11. Manage student behavior in accordance with Student Code of Conduct and student handbook.

12. Take all necessary and reasonable precautions to protect students, equipment, materials, and

facilities.

13. Assist in selecting books, equipment, and other instructional materials.

14. Compile, maintain, and file all reports, records, and other documents required.

Communication

15. Establish and maintain a professional relationship and open communication with parents,

students, colleagues, and community members.

Professional Growth and Development

16. Participate in staff development activities to improve job-related skills.

17. Comply with state, district, and school regulations and policies for classroom teachers.

18. Attend and participate in faculty meetings and serve on staff committees as required.

Additional Duties:

19. Any and all other duties as assigned by your immediate supervisor.

Supervisory Responsibilities:

Direct the work of assigned instructional aide(s).
